Jason Taylor's cap hit is too prohibitive for us.

I've given up the fight for Shane Olivea or Barry Sims. The FO has rolled the dice with old, fat, slow Oliver Ross and - gag - Mruc.

Lito to NE isn't dead yet; it all depends on how well the coaches feel that our own CBs - rookies & vets - are progressing.

I would love to have Greg Wesley as Stomper's backup at FS, if The Price is Right. But, he has yet to be released.

And neither has LaMont Jordan. Should that happen, he could be a less-expensive alternate to Kevin Jones.

KJ to da Bears? It wouldn't surprise me. He cost more than he did just 2 days ago, that's for sure.

Jeremy Shockey would cost too much (in draft picks) to acquire, unless Bennie Watson hits the IR during TC, and Dave Thomas can't go full bore yet.

Ocho Cinco = Mucho Cancer.

The R-a-t-s would never, ever trade/release Chris Baker to the NEP.
